One solution would be to use `local-require`:

    (((let () (local-require (only-in racket/function curry)) curry) + ) 2)

> I’ve written a meta-language that adds function literal syntax to the
> reader, inspired by Clojure and Rackjure’s shorthand function literals. It
> uses curly braces for these literals, so #{+ 2 %} reads as (lambda (%) (+ 2
> %)).
>
> This actually works great, but I also want to add a feature that the
> shorthand syntax becomes a shorthand for curry if no arguments are
> specified, so #{+ 2} reads as ((curry +) 2). This works fine when the
> language I pass to my meta-language is racket, but it fails in racket/base
> because the curry function is from racket/function, which hasn’t been
> instantiated. This is the error I get:
>
> require: namespace mismatch;
>  reference to a module that is not available
>   reference phase: 0
>   referenced module: "~/gits/racket/racket/collects/racket/function.rkt"
>   referenced phase level: 0 in: curry
>
> Is there any way for my meta-language to force this to be instantiated
> whenever my meta-language is used? I’m using make-meta-reader from
> syntax/module-reader to implement my meta-language.
